Archbishop Carroll fell victim to Immaculata-La Salle and their airtight pitching crew on Thursday. They fell just short of the Immaculata-La Salle Royal Lions by a score of 2-0. Give some credit to the fans of both teams: the last five times they've met, the home team has come away the winner.

ADRIAN GARCIA was a force to be reckoned with on the mound despite the final result: he pitched six innings while giving up just one earned (and one unearned) run off six hits. The dominant performance also gave him a new career-high in strikeouts (five).
Archbishop Carroll moved to 7-6-1 with that loss, which also ended their four-game winning streak. A key ingredient in that success has been their performance when it comes to hits: they averaged an imposing 9.5 hits in those games compared to only 5.2 in the others. As for Immaculata-La Salle, they are on a roll lately: they've won five of their last six matches. That's provided a nice bump to their 8-3 record this season.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Archbishop Carroll will take on Florida Christian at 7:15 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Immaculata-La Salle, they will challenge Miami Christian at 3:30 p.m. on Wednesday.
